E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
EntrySet
Java中遍历Map的几种方法总结
Mapmap=newHashMap();for(Map.Entryentry:map.
entrySet
()){System.out.println("Key="+entry.getKey()+",Value
_MrLiu
·
2020-06-24 21:47
java
java泛型之Map
String[]args){Personp1=newPerson("小红",18);Personp=newPerson("xiaoming",22);Mapmen=newHashMapentry:men.
entrySet
mrz97
·
2020-06-24 15:23
java的本质系列
遍历Map的常用方法
entrySet
()
Map提供了一些常用方法,如keySet()、
entrySet
()等方法,keySet()方法返回值是Map中key值的集合;
entrySet
()的返回值也是返回一个Set集合,此集合的类型为Map.Entry
一只草履虫
·
2020-06-24 09:09
java
TreeMap按照value进行排序
所以网上看了一下,大致的思路是把TreeMap的
EntrySet
转换成list,然后使用
赶路人儿
·
2020-06-24 07:47
java
java HashMap 遍历
javaMap遍历速度最优解第一种:Mapmap=newHashMap();Iteratoriter=map.
entrySet
().iterator();while(iter.hasNext()){Map.Entryentry
纠结嘚那些小情绪1
·
2020-06-24 04:25
java基础
Java遍历Map对象的四种方法(HashMap泛型)
Java遍历Map对象的四种方法(Map泛型)1.使用
entrySet
遍历2.使用keySet、values遍历3.使用Iterator遍历4.使用Lambda遍历5.总结添加map模拟数据Mapmap
泽虞生的Tap
·
2020-06-23 23:04
java
java基础--集合----单列集合和双列集合遍历
Map提供了一些常用方法,如keySet()、
entrySet
()等方法,keySet()方法返回值
Alex十年
·
2020-06-23 17:16
java
Java中HashMap遍历几种方式
目录一、使用迭代器二、foreach遍历一、使用迭代器第一种:Mapmap=newHashMap();Iteratoriter=map.
entrySet
().iterator();while(iter.hasNext
gary0917
·
2020-06-23 09:40
Java
Java8中Map的遍历方式总结
publicclassLambdaMap{privateMapmap=newHashMapSystem.out.println("map.get("+key+")="+map.get(key)));}/***遍历Map第二种*通过Map.
entrySet
梨花飘香
·
2020-06-23 08:17
map
Java LinkedHashMap获取第一个元素和最后一个元素
年10月27日在Java.获取LinkedHashMap中的头部元素(最早添加的元素):时间复杂度O(1)publicEntrygetHead(LinkedHashMapmap){returnmap.
entrySet
javaPie
·
2020-06-23 06:24
JAVA
java map里面进行ASCII 码从小到大排序(字典序)
publicstaticStringgetAsciiSort(Mapmap){List>infoIds=newArrayList>(map.
entrySet
());//对所有传入参数按照字段名的ASCII
QH.Thomas
·
2020-06-22 16:00
Mapreduce(4)------遍历map的四种方法及Map.entry详解
转自---https://blog.csdn.net/gm371200587/article/details/82108372Map.
entrySet
()这个方法返回的是一个Set>,Map.Entry
咫片炫
·
2020-06-22 15:00
HashMap排序题
写一个方式实现map的排序功能,*该方法的返回值与传入的参数均为Hashmap*要求对hashmap中的元素进行倒叙排列,排序时key与value的值不许拆开**/Mapmap=newHashMap>
entrySet
a1104277306
·
2020-06-22 10:32
getHarmonic函数
privateint[]getHarmonic(intx){intcount=0;intp=0;//加权int[]harmonics=newint[VIE_NUM];for(Entrye:roleId_Score.
entrySet
孙墨潇
·
2020-06-22 07:23
HashMap之如何正确遍历并删除元素
HashMapmyHashMap;for(Map.entryitem:myHashMap.
entrySet
()){Kkey=item.getKey();Vval=item.getValue();//todowithkeyandval
VicterTian
·
2020-06-22 06:16
学习笔记
Java:HashMap按键值排序
Set>array=map.
entrySet
();4.从上述mapEntries创建LinkedList。我们
一生所爱丶
·
2020-06-21 19:46
Java
HashMap中常用方法的总结
Objectkey)3.size()4.clear()5.isEmpty()6.remove(Objectkey)四.HashMap中的遍历1.使用values()方法2.使用keySet()3.使用
entrySet
AnFooo
·
2020-06-21 19:04
【leetcode】347. Top K Frequent Elements
classSolution{publicListtopKFrequent(int[]nums,intk){HashMapmap=newHashMapres=newArrayListentry:map.
entrySet
AXIMI
·
2020-06-21 16:07
leetcode
Redis中PipeLine使用(二)---批量get与批量set
批量查询的相关问题总结再做测试之前首先向redis中批量插入一组数据1-->12-->23-->34-->45-->56-->6现在批量get数据for(Entryentry:map.
entrySet
(
奇点一氪
·
2020-06-21 14:57
Edgar--java学习--小说hashmap
map是双列存储是一个对键值对key与valueList、Set、Map都可以通过迭代器来遍历先看hashmap1.无序//没有索引所以后期遍历的时候我们只能通过迭代器遍历//两种一种是keyset一种是
entryset
2
EdgarSpring
·
2020-06-02 17:39
Java基础
如何在java 8 map中使用stream
创建一个Map:MapsomeMap=newHashMap>entries=someMap.
entrySet
();获取map的key:SetkeySet=so
flydean程序那些事
·
2020-04-24 09:44
9.9-全栈Java笔记:遍历集合的N种方式总结&Collections工具类
SetkeySet=maps.keySet();for(Integerid:keySet){System.out.println(maps.get(id).name);}【示例8】遍历Map方法2,使用
entrySet
全栈JAVA笔记
·
2020-04-14 01:36
HashMap排序
publicclassSortMapByValues{publicstaticvoidmain(String[]args){MapaMap=newHashMapaMap){Set>mapEntries=aMap.
entrySet
SummerC0ld
·
2020-04-12 12:55
java day 14
Map提供了一些常用方法,如keySet()、
entrySet
()等方法。
Tertou萧燚
·
2020-04-10 05:53
Map接口的实现类
synchronized函数),而HashMap不同步,所以HashTable要慢一些HashTable不接受null键和值,而HashMap接受一个null键和无数个null值除了keySet(),
entrySet
言西枣
·
2020-04-10 01:47
java Map的keySet和
entrySet
entrySet
:返回值为:Set>将map集合中的映射关系存入set集合中,而这个关系的数据类型就是Map.EntrypublicclassMapDemo{publicstatic
hongxiao2020
·
2020-04-07 21:00
遍历 HashMap 的四种方式
entrySet
()获取map中所有的键值对.iterator()拿到迭代器遍历迭代器is.hasNext()判断集合是否还有元素可以遍历n
lankeren
·
2020-04-06 18:43
hashmap
java
iterator
foreach
键值对
导出接口生成excel
由于集合中的任意一个元素都是excel中任意一行的完整数据,所以对mapList.get(0).
entrySet
()进行for循环得到key的集合,即对应的表中字段集合。
墨色尘埃
·
2020-04-06 03:48
集合-map01-
entrySet
()方法
publicstaticvoidmain(String[]args){Mapmap=newHashMap();map.put("Tom","CoreJava");map.put("John","Oracle");map.put("Susan","Oracle");map.put("Jerry","JDBC");map.put("Jim","Unix");map.put("Kevin","JSP")
JR_咖啡少年
·
2020-03-28 13:24
聊聊HashMap、ConcurrentHashMap和HashTable
1、HashMap1.1、了解HashMap首先了解以下几个参数:①capacity容量默认是staticfinalintDEFAULT_INITIAL_CAPACITY=1entry:map.
entrySet
Bardon_X
·
2020-03-27 14:52
java Map遍历最优
遍历方式详细比较看这里综合就几句代码同时遍历key和value时,keySet与
entrySet
方法的性能差异取决于key的具体情况,如复杂度(复杂对象)、离散度、冲突率等。
else05
·
2020-03-27 13:26
JDK容器学习之HashMap (一) : 底层存储结构分析
jdkmap学习之HashMap(一):底层存储结构分析by一灰底层数据结构首先通过源码,类中的field如下,transientNode[]table;transientSet>
entrySet
;transientintsize
一灰灰blog
·
2020-03-27 10:48
Iterator (迭代器)遍历效率比较
第一种:Mapmap=newHashMap();Iteratoriter=map.
entrySet
().iterator();while(iter.hasNext()){Map.Entryentry=(
yu_yue
·
2020-03-24 14:14
Java5种遍历HashMap数据的写法
本文介绍了最好的Java5种遍历HashMap数据的写法,分享给大家,也给自己留一个笔记,具体如下:通过
EntrySet
的迭代器遍历Iterator>iterator=coursesMap.
entrySet
spt_genius
·
2020-03-24 08:24
`keyset`的使用和实现
keyset的使用和实现HashMap(2):
EntrySet
、KeySet实现原理HashMap中keySet()底层调用解析keyset可以获取Map中所有的key值,查看keyset方法。
uranusleon
·
2020-03-23 14:55
387. First Unique Character in a String
LeetCodeLinkpublicintfirstUniqChar(Strings){LinkedHashMapuniqMap=newLinkedHashMapdupSet=newHashSet>iter=uniqMap.
entrySet
Super_Alan
·
2020-03-23 10:17
Map接口与抽象类
一.Map部分结构图image.png二.Map接口image.png三.AbstractMap抽象类供子类实现的方法:put,entrySetMap的增删改查都是通过获取Iterator>i=
entrySet
蜗牛1991
·
2020-03-20 10:59
遍历hashmap用keySet不如用
entrySet
效率高
而
entryset
只是遍历了第一次,他把key和value都放到了entry中,所以就快了。
jackie_shawn
·
2020-03-19 22:28
HashMap 的两种遍历方式
第一种Mapmap=newHashMap();Iteratoriter=map.
entrySet
().iterator();while(iter.hasNext()){Map.Entryentry=(Map.Entry
coding_king
·
2020-03-19 18:53
Java Stream
=null&&t.getId()>0).collect(groupingBy(DO::getGId,summingInt(DO::getNumber))).
entrySet
().stream().map
bigfish1129
·
2020-03-15 09:38
JDK 1.8 源码分析之 集合框架 HashMap (1)
源码希望能对大家帮助我的公众号微信公众号首先看静态成员成员变量//默认的初始容量是16staticfinalintDEFAULT_INITIAL_CAPACITY=1[]table;transientSet>
entrySet
Gxgeek
·
2020-03-14 18:57
Java的HashMap中的常用方法总结
HashMap在编程中是一个非常有用的工具,使用的频率很高,所以本文简单总结一下hashmap的常用方法遍历HashMap可以通过
entryset
取得iter,然后逐个遍历Iteratorit=mp.
entrySet
六尺帐篷
·
2020-03-13 19:04
Map 集合遍历的方法
二次取值(常用)for(Stringkey:map.keySet()){System.out.println("key="+key+"andvalue="+map.get(key));}2.通过Map.
entrySet
红叶丶秋鸣
·
2020-03-10 21:44
API请求签名加密,备注
params.put("username","test");params.put("password","test");StringqueryString="";for(Map.Entryentry:params.
entrySet
假装是程序猿
·
2020-03-04 22:44
Map遍历方式方式及性能测试
JavaMap遍历方式方式及性能测试1.阐述对于Java中Map的遍历方式,很多文章都推荐使用
entrySet
,认为其比keySet的效率高很多。
藝龍
·
2020-03-04 14:02
Android SharedPreferences存储map的方法
publicstaticvoidputHashMapData(Contextcontext,Stringkey,Mapdatas){JSONArraymJsonArray=newJSONArray();Iterator>iterator=datas.
entrySet
喵主子的阳光
·
2020-03-04 03:22
java反序列化-ysoserial-调试分析总结篇(3)
只是反射调用方法是用的不是invokeTransformer而用的是InstantiateTransformer,整个调用过程如下图利用链分析:如上图所示,入口点还是Annotationinvoationhandler的
Entryset
tr1ple
·
2020-03-01 21:00
Java 集合框架_AbstractMap
AbstractMap类是Map接口的子类,实现了Map接口大部分方法,它的子类只需要实现Set>
entrySet
()返回一个键值对的集合,就可以使用Map集合的功能了。
wo883721
·
2020-03-01 10:48
Java中的Map,Set,List遍历
importjava.util.Map;publicclassMapTraversing{publicstaticvoidmain(String[]args){Mapmap=newHashMap>it=map.
entrySet
拾荒者的笔记
·
2020-02-29 23:30
HashMap遍历效率
importjava.util.Iterator;importjava.util.Map;publicstaticvoidmain(String[]args){Mapmap=newHashMap();for(inti=0;ientry:map.
entrySet
柯南vs金田一一
·
2020-02-27 22:39
上一页
16
17
18
19
20
21
22
23
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他